Who has experience with comparing (Propane)Gas prices?
Here in Los Cabos Gaspasa is increasing prices "by the hour", or let`s say: Every Month. A 45 Gallon Tank now costs $700. Just 5 Month ago it was $490. Friends in Mulege are complaining the same. Well, between Gro.Negro and Loreto, Gaspasa has no competition as far as I know. So they can overcharge people as easy as 1,2,3. No competition always is bad!!!

at least in La Paz propane is sold by the liter - not by kg

ncampion - 3-15-2016 at 03:13 PM

I have also noticed the price of propane double over the past few years, not sure what is the driver of this product. I do know that filling the typical BBQ tank (5gal?) costs about $120 pesos, whereas filling the same tank in the US is around $25USD. So it's still OK in my book.

The latest price for propane in the Ensenada region is about $7.88 m.n. Pesos per liter.
